Understanding the Target: School Boards and Educational Institutions

School boards represent a prime target for cybercriminals for several compelling reasons. First, they often possess large amounts of sensitive data, including personally identifiable information (PII) on students, staff, and parents. This data is highly valuable on the dark web, commanding high prices for identity theft and other illicit activities. Second, many school districts are perceived to have weaker cybersecurity defenses compared to larger corporations, making them easier targets. Third, the reputational damage resulting from a data breach can be devastating for a school district, putting pressure on them to pay a ransom to avoid negative publicity.

The Mechanics of the Attack: Exploiting Vulnerabilities

The exact techniques used in the PowerSchool breach are still under investigation. However, several likely scenarios are emerging:

  • Software Vulnerabilities: Attackers may have exploited known vulnerabilities in the PowerSchool software itself or in third-party applications integrated with the platform. These vulnerabilities could allow attackers to gain unauthorized access to the system and exfiltrate sensitive data.
  • Phishing and Social Engineering: Cybercriminals might have used phishing emails or other social engineering tactics to trick employees into revealing their credentials, providing a backdoor into the PowerSchool system. This is a common attack vector that often proves effective.
  • Ransomware Deployment: Once inside the system, the attackers may have deployed ransomware to encrypt data and demand a ransom for its release. This tactic is becoming increasingly prevalent, disrupting operations and causing significant financial damage.

The Legal Landscape: Navigating FERPA and Other Regulations

The PowerSchool breach raises critical legal and regulatory questions surrounding data privacy. The Family Educational Rights and Privacy Act (FERPA) in the United States protects the privacy of student education records. Violations of FERPA can result in significant penalties for educational institutions. Similarly, the General Data Protection Regulation (GDPR) in Europe imposes stringent requirements for the protection of personal data. School districts must ensure they are compliant with all applicable regulations to avoid legal repercussions.

Moving Forward: Building a Stronger Cybersecurity Defense

The PowerSchool breach serves as a stark reminder of the importance of robust cybersecurity measures in educational institutions. School districts must prioritize the following:

  • Invest in Cybersecurity Infrastructure: This includes implementing advanced security technologies such as firewalls, intrusion detection systems, and endpoint protection solutions.
  • Regular Security Audits and Penetration Testing: These activities can identify vulnerabilities in the system before attackers can exploit them.
  • Employee Training: Educating staff about cybersecurity threats, phishing scams, and safe password practices is crucial.
  • Incident Response Planning: Develop a comprehensive incident response plan to address data breaches and other cybersecurity incidents effectively. This plan should outline clear communication protocols with law enforcement, parents, and students.
  • Multi-Factor Authentication (MFA): Implementing MFA adds an extra layer of security, making it much more difficult for attackers to gain unauthorized access to accounts.
  • Data Encryption: Encrypting sensitive data both in transit and at rest protects it from unauthorized access even if a breach occurs.
  • Regular Software Updates and Patching: Keeping software updated with the latest security patches is critical to closing known vulnerabilities.
  • Third-Party Risk Management: Carefully vet and monitor third-party vendors who have access to sensitive data. Ensure they have adequate security measures in place.
